INTRODUCTION:In 2010, 6.8% of the Portuguese adults had asthma. Contemporary studies employing more accurate methods are needed. We aimed to assess asthma prevalence in Portugal and to identify associated-factors. METHODS:A population-based nationwide study was conducted from May 2021 to March 2024. A multistage random sampling approach was applied to select adults from primary care. Stage 1 involved a telephone screening interview to collect socio-demographic and clinical data. Patients with an Adult Asthma Score (A2 Score) ≥1 were eligible for Stage 2, and 5% of those with an A2 Score = 0 were also invited to participate in Stage 2, which consisted of a diagnostic visit with a physical examination and diagnostic tests. We computed weighted asthma prevalence estimates and multivariable logistic regression models were used. RESULTS:A total of 7,556 participants completed Stage 1 and 1,857 Stage 2. The prevalence of asthma was 7.1% (95%CI = 6.3-8.0%), with slight differences by sex, age, and region. Education, family history of asthma, inhaler prescription, nasal/ocular symptoms, food allergies, and previous allergy skin tests were associated with an increased risk of asthma (R2 = 33%). Asthma diagnosis could also be predicted by the A2 score, either on its own (R2 = 43%) or in combination with family history and previous allergy skin tests (R2 = 45%). DISCUSSION:Asthma affects 7.1% of Portuguese adults. Family history of asthma, nasal/ocular symptoms, and comorbid food allergy are associated with increased risk of asthma.
Digital health can effectively engage patients in the self-management of their asthma. Still, it will only reach its full potential when apps are aligned with patients’ needs and are integrated into clinical practice. We aim to test a framework for the involvement of patients/carers in all phases of developing and implementing an app for asthma. This protocol was co-designed with six asthma patients/carers and includes 5 tasks. Regular interactions among patients, developers and healthcare professionals will be a priority for user requirements definition (task 1) and iterative development and testing until the app’s initial version (tasks 2-3). Patients/carers and healthcare professionals will be fully engaged in the real-life feasibility study (task 4) and management and dissemination activities (task 5). The eligibility criteria to participate in tasks 2-4 are 1) diagnosis of asthma or carer of a person with asthma; 2) ≥18 years; 3) ability to use apps and access a mobile device with Internet. We anticipate applying questionnaires such as the User Experience Questionnaire and the System Usability Scale in all app testing tasks. We expect to have a final version of the asthma app that meets patients’/carers’ needs and experiences and healthcare professionals’ concerns. This will be an attractive app to support patients in self-management of their disease, keeping their asthma in control, having fewer asthma symptoms, and enjoying life. This study will be a framework for fully involving patients, carers and citizens in the iterative co-production development and implementation of an asthma app.
Physaloptera spp. are parasitic nematodes that infect the gastrointestinal tracts of many carnivores and omnivores. Although they are distributed worldwide, Physaloptera spp. have not been studied in raptors in Portugal. In this study, we report Physaloptera alata in a booted eagle (Aquila pennata) in Portugal. Adult nematodes were discovered in the gizzard of a young booted eagle, and morphological features were consistent with those of the genus Physaloptera. DNA was extracted and a PCR assay performed to amplify a region of the 18S small subunit of the ribosomal RNA gene and the cytochrome c oxidase subunit I gene. The resulting PCR products were Sanger-sequenced, and comparison with the available sequences in the GenBank database confirmed the initial morphological classification as Physaloptera sp. Phylogenetic analysis clustered the sequence within the Physaloptera group. The presence of this parasite in raptors from Portugal is of particular importance to wildlife rehabilitation centers, disease ecologists, and wildlife professionals. Furthermore, we produced a new genetic sequence and have added it to the GenBank database of parasites in birds of prey.

Lung auscultation using smartphones9 built-in microphone is a promising technology to monitor respiratory conditions outside medical facilities. We aimed to compare lung sounds acquired by smartphones with the ones acquired by a digital stethoscope according to their quality and ability to capture adventitious sounds. A cross-sectional study was conducted with 17 adults with self-reported asthma (13 females, 35±12y). Lung auscultation was performed by clinicians in 7 different locations (trachea; right and left anterior, upper posterior and lower posterior chest), first with a digital stethoscope and then with the patient's smartphone. Recordings from smartphones (n=119) and the stethoscope (n=119) were independently classified according to their quality and presence of adventitious sounds by two annotators. A third annotator solved the disagreements. The quality of the recordings was higher with the digital stethoscope than with smartphones (84% vs. 59%, p<.001). Adventitious sounds were present in 3% of the recordings acquired with smartphones and in 9% of those acquired with the digital stethoscope (p=.109). Agreement regarding presence of adventitious sounds between smartphones and stethoscope was slight (86%, k=.14 (95%CI -.14-.41). Results showed a better agreement between the two annotators for recordings quality (88%, k=.70(95%CI. 60-.81)) than for the presence of adventitious sounds (79%, k=.22(95%CI. 05-.38)). Smartphone auscultation seems a viable approach to record lung sounds and to capture adventitious sounds, although its performance is yet to be comparable to digital auscultation. Further research is required to improve this technology.
Introduction In Portugal as in other countries, data on the epidemiology of asthma are mainly grounded in questionnaire studies. Additionally, the detailed characterisation of asthma in terms of disease severity, control and phenotypes remain scarce. Studies assessing the prevalence of asthma and its subgroups using accurate methods are needed. This study aims to determine the prevalence of asthma, difficult-to-treat asthma and severe asthma, and to evaluate sociodemographic and clinical characteristics of those patients, in mainland Portugal. Methods and analysis A population-based nationwide study with a multicentre stepwise approach will be conducted between 2021 and 2023 in 38 primary care centres of the Portuguese National Health Service. The stepwise approach will comprise four stages: Stage 0—telephone call invitation to adult subjects (≥18 years) randomly selected (n~15 000); stage 1—telephone screening interview assessing the participants’ respiratory symptoms (n~7500); stage 2—diagnostic visit, including physical examination, diagnostic tests (eg, spirometry, fraction of exhaled nitric oxide, blood eosinophil count) and patient-reported outcome measures for diagnostic confirmation of those identified with possible asthma at stage 1 (n~1800); stage 3—further evaluation of patients with asthma and of patients with difficult-to-treat asthma and severe asthma, after 3 months (n~460). At stage 3, data will be collected from a review of the patient’s electronic health records, a follow-up telephone call and the CARATm (Caracteristicas Auto-reportadas de Asma em Tecnologias Móveis) app database. The prevalence of asthma, difficult-to-treat asthma and severe asthma will be determined as the percentage of patients with asthma confirmed from the overall population (stage 1). For the analysis of factors associated with asthma, difficult-to-treat asthma and severe asthma, logistic regression models will be explored. Ethics and dissemination Ethical approvals for the study were obtained from the ethics committee of the local health unit of Matosinhos, Porto (38/CES/JAS), Alto Minho (38/2021/CES) and the regional health administration of Lisbon-Vale do Tejo (035/CES/INV/2021). Results will be published in peer-reviewed journals. Trial registration number NCT05169619 .
Objective:To assess the feasibility of the procedures of EPI-ASTHMA. EPI-ASTHMA is a population-based multicentre stepwise study about the prevalence and characterisation of patients with asthma based on disease severity in Portugal.Methods:A pilot study of EPI-ASTHMA was conducted with adults from three primary care centres. We followed a stepwise approach comprising 4 stages: stage 0-invitation phone call (n ~1316); stage 1-telephone interview (n ~658); stage 2-clinical assessment with physical examination, diagnostic tests, and patient-reported outcome measures, to confirm the diagnosis of those with possible asthma at stage 1 (n ~160); stage 3-characterization of a subgroup of asthma patients by collecting data through a telephone interview, patient file review and CARATm app (n ~40), after 3-months. The frequency of asthma was calculated in relation to the entire study population (stage 1) and the frequency of difficult-to-treat/severe asthma in relation to the number of asthma patients (stage 3).Results:From 1305 adults invited, 892 (68%) accepted to participate (stage 0) and 574 (64%; 53[42-67] y; 43% male) were interviewed (stage 1). From those, 148 (26%; 60[46-68] y; 43% male) were assessed at stage 2, and 46 (31%; 51[39-67] y; 44% male) were diagnosed with asthma. Half of these patients (n = 23) accepted to install the app. Stage 3 was completed by 41 (93%) patients, of whom 31 (83%) had asthma confirmed by their file review. A total of 8% of participants had asthma, of those 17% had difficult-to-treat and 5% severe asthma.Conclusion:Attained recruitment rates and the quality of the results confirmed the feasibility of the EPI-ASTHMA stepwise approach. This pilot study provided insight into the improvement of the procedures to be generalized across the country.
The paper version of CARAT (pCARAT) is valid to assess asthma control over a 4-week period. For follow-up purposes, assessment through mobile apps (aCARAT) or telephone (tCARAT) may be useful alternatives. We explored the psychometric properties of the aCARAT and tCARAT. Patients with asthma were recruited at secondary care outpatient clinics. During medical visits, patients filled in the pCARAT and were invited to complete the aCARAT in the following days using the app of project Inspirers (InspirerMundi). After 1 week, tCARAT was collected. Patients completing the 3 CARAT versions within 28 days were analysed. CARAT scores (0-worst, 30-best) were calculated. The internal consistency (Cronbach’s α), convergent validity (Spearman correlation-rs) and reliability (intraclass correlation coefficient-ICC, Bland-Altman analysis) were determined. 55 patients (21 male; median 19 [interquartile range 17-37]y) were included. The aCARAT was completed by 82% of patients within 1 week of pCARAT; and by 78% within 1 week of tCARAT. The median pCARAT score was 21[17-24], the aCARAT 21[18-26], and the tCARAT 23[21-26]. Internal consistency was good for all versions (α=.73-.77). pCARAT was more strongly correlated with aCARAT than with tCARAT. Reliability was better for aCARAT than for tCARAT (table 1). App and telephonic CARAT versions are valid and reliable, exhibiting comparable psychometric properties to the paper version. These new CARAT versions are promising alternatives for assessing control in patients with asthma.
Evaluation of lung function is central to the management of chronic obstructive respiratory diseases. It is typically evaluated with a spirometer by a specialized health professional, who ensures the correct execution of a forced expiratory manoeuvre (FEM). Audio recording of a FEM using a smart device embedded microphone can be used to self-monitor lung function between clinical visits. The challenge of microphone spirometry is to ensure the validity and reliability of the FEM, in the absence of a health professional. In particular, the absence of a mouthpiece may allow excessive mouth closure, leading to an incorrect manoeuvre. In this work, a strategy to automatically assess the correct execution of the FEM is proposed and validated. Using 498 FEM recordings, both specificity and sensitivity attained were above 90%. This method provides immediate feedback to the user, by grading the manoeuvre in a visual scale, promoting the repetition of the FEM when needed.
Smart device microphone spirometry, based on the audio recording of forced expiratory maneuver (FEM), can be a simple, ubiquitous and easy tool for patients to self-monitor their asthma. Automatic validity assessment is crucial to guarantee that the global effort of the FEM fulfil the admissible minimum or if the maneuver needs to be repeated. In this work an automatic method to classify the sounds from FEM with respect to global effort was developed and evaluated using data from 54 children (5-10 years). The method proposed was able to correctly classify the microphone spirometry with respect to admissible minimum of effort with an accuracy of 86% (specificity 87% and sensitivity 86%). This method can be used to provide immediate feedback of the correct execution of the maneuver, improving the clinical value and utility of this self-monitoring tool.

Tin (Sn) or a Sn-rich solder applied to copper-based artefacts has been frequently used at least, since the Ancient Greece, although scarce studies have been published concerning the technology of this metallurgical joining technique. Several filler remnants were reported to be found in a Roman collection of handle attachments of situlae or cauldrons (2nd century BCE-5th century CE) from the archaeological site of Conimbriga, a Roman city from the Lusitania Province (Portugal). All these artefacts were cast in high leaded coppers and bronzes. The present study aims to contribute to the knowledge of Sn-rich soldering, an ancient metallurgical joining technique, by the characterisation of the fusible metallic alloy present in 10 Roman artefacts by means of micro-energy dispersive X-ray fluorescence spectrometry (micro-EDXRF), scanning electron microscopy with energy dispersive X-ray (SEM-EDS) microanalysis and optical microscope (OM) observations. Results of studied solders show the presence of Cu-Sn alloys, with Sn contents ranging from 8 toll phase composition (30-60 wt% Sn). As the attachments were made in leaded copper alloys, it was also observed, in some cases, the melting of the interdendritic Pb-rich chains with long-range diffusion of the solder alloy into the substrate. The fillers compositions suggest that the handle attachments have been joined to a situla body by the soldering metallurgical process with Sn or a Sn-rich alloy. The studied leaded Cu-Sn attachments, probably formulated by local craftsman, were joined into the body of a situla or cauldron with a soft solder (soldering), a common metallurgical joint from Antiquity, although no relation was found between composition or typology and the Sn or Sn-rich solder. The CARAT is valid to assess asthma control using paper-based forms. For follow-up purposes, telephone interview may be useful, but equivalence between these modes of administration was not studied. This study compared CARAT scores when administered via paper-based forms and telephone interview 1-week apart. Patients with asthma, recruited during scheduled medical visits in 4 secondary care centers, filled in the paper-based CARAT. After 3-7 days (median-M 6), CARAT was again collected by telephone interview. CARAT scores (from 0-worst to 30-best; >24 controlled) were obtained. The internal consistency (Cronbach’s α), test-retest reliability (intraclass correlation coefficient-ICC2,1) and agreement (Cohen9s kappa) were calculated. A total of 45 patients (23 male; M=21[interquartil range-IQR 19] years) were included. The CARAT median score was 22[IQR 10.5] in paper-based forms and 22[IQR 9.5] in telephone interview (p=.098). Twenty-one patients (47%) had a difference of 0-1 point between the 2 moments. Only 10 patients (22%) had a difference above the minimal clinically important difference (MCID≥4). The Cronbach’s α was 0.85 for paper-based CARAT and 0.79 for telephone interview. The ICC was 0.87 (95%CI 0.78-0.93; p<0.001). Classification of asthma control was concordant between the 2 methods in 39 (87%) patients (kappa=0.7; p<0.001). The CARAT score change above the MCID may be related to clinical changes in the previous week influencing the 4-week recall period. Telephonic administration of CARAT is an alternative approach to conventional paper-based forms in patients with asthma.
